Output 16dd8612318b80401bfa1e469dc6cf5a16bf9a4f9d726ea2a07a658a5f14e785:14

value
94281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8337f095944b59f7e78915e3508b552e76fad031 OP_EQUAL
address
3DeqTSLsmV7f6xXXrobeRdzHSL6XFkBy9H
transaction
16dd8612318b80401bfa1e469dc6cf5a16bf9a4f9d726ea2a07a658a5f14e785
spent
true